West Expands Corning Collaboration and Launches First Product

Thursday, February 09, 2023

West Pharmaceutical Services announces the expansion of its landmark collaboration with Corning Incorporated including the exclusive distribution rights for Corning Valour® Glass vials and the launch of its first product, West Ready Pack™ with Corning Valour® RTU Vials utilising SG EZ-fill® technology.

The West Ready Pack™ with Corning Valour® RTU Vials combines West's highest quality NovaPure® stoppers, Flip-Off® CCS (Clean, Certified, Sterilised) seals and Corning's best-in-class Valour® RTU Vials with SG EZ-fill® technology into a complete containment solution to help bring parenteral drugs and diagnostics to market.

The Ready Pack™ combination of NovaPure® stoppers, Flip-Off® CCS seals, and Valour® RTU Vials with SG EZ-fill® technology provides the following benefits to drug developers:

•    Proven Container Closure Integrity (CCI) including the ability to maintain cold storage CCI when cooled to and stored at -80°C;
•    Sterile ready-to-use format that can be directly introduced into filling operations, eliminating the need for component preparation;
•    Premium components with the tightest particulate specifications in West's offering; and
•    Availability in quantities suitable for small-scale filling operations with continuity to quantity options for large-scale commercial operations.
